How to Achieve the Perfect Pointy Nail Shape
Step-by-Step Guide to Shaping Pointy Nails
Creating the perfect pointy shape requires precision and patience. Start by filing your nails to a slightly rounded shape, then gradually bring the sides inward to form the desired point. For best results, use a fine-grit file and work slowly to avoid breaking or damaging the nail.
Tools You’ll Need for Pointy Nails
To achieve the sharpest pointy nails, make sure you have the right tools. You’ll need a quality nail file, buffer, cuticle pusher, and a nail clipper. Nail forms or stiletto nail tips can also help if you prefer a more dramatic shape.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
When shaping pointy nails, avoid over-filing, as this can cause breakage. It’s also essential to maintain a consistent shape and avoid making the point too sharp, as this could lead to discomfort or injury.
Nail Care Tips for Pointy Nails
Maintaining Healthy Pointy Nails
To keep your nail designs pointy looking their best, regular nail care is essential. Moisturize your nails and cuticles, and use a strengthening nail polish to prevent chipping and breaking. Additionally, make sure to apply a top coat to seal your designs and keep them glossy.
Preventing Breakage and Damage
Pointy nails are more prone to breakage due to their sharp tips. To prevent damage, avoid using your nails as tools, and try to keep your nails trimmed and filed regularly to avoid overextending them.
